Tragic storyline is close to home for Neeson and son – Sydney Morning Herald
Liam Neeson’s latest movie has some emotional connections to the actor’s own past.

The script was the work of James DArcy, a British actor and first-time filmmaker who lost his father at a similar age; he had originally conceived the sons part for himself. Robert, the father, is a famous painter, ostensibly living an artists life of drink and debauchery but no longer producing art. His son Jack has built a thriving gallery financed by his in-laws, but is about to lose it; his wife is divorcing him and taking her parents patronage with her.
